What You'll Need Before You Log In

Before we dive into the actual login steps, let's make sure you've got everything ready. Think of this as your pre-flight checklist, guys! You don't want to get halfway through and realize you're missing a crucial piece of information. So, what do you need? First off, you'll likely need a registered username and password. If you haven't registered on the portal before, you'll need to complete the registration process first. This usually involves providing some basic personal details, like your name, contact information, and possibly your Aadhaar number, depending on the specific portal's requirements. Make sure you use an email address and phone number that you actively check, because they might be used for verification or for sending important updates. Secondly, keep your registered mobile number handy. Sometimes, a One-Time Password (OTP) is sent to your registered mobile number as part of the login or verification process. So, having your phone nearby and unlocked is a good idea. For new registrations, you might also need details for creating a strong password – something secure but memorable. Think a mix of upper and lowercase letters, numbers, and symbols. And finally, ensure you have a stable internet connection. While not a physical item, a patchy connection can turn a quick login into a frustrating ordeal. Having these few things sorted will make the entire Janam Praman Patra website login process a breeze. Step-by-Step Login Process

Alright, let's get down to the nitty-gritty, the actual Janam Praman Patra website login. It’s pretty much like logging into any other online service, so you've probably got this! First things first, you need to open your web browser – Chrome, Firefox, Safari, whatever you usually use – and navigate to the official Janam Praman Patra website. Pro tip: Always make sure you're on the official government website to avoid any fake or phishing sites. You can usually find the correct URL through your local government's website or a quick search for the specific state's birth certificate portal. Once you're on the homepage, look for the 'Login' or 'Sign In' button. It's typically located in the top right corner of the page, but sometimes it might be more prominent, like a big button in the middle. Click on that button, and you should be directed to the login page. Here’s where you'll enter your username or registered email ID and your password. Carefully type these in. Double-check for any typos, especially in your password, as it's case-sensitive. After entering your credentials, you'll usually see a 'Captcha' code to enter. This is a security measure to prove you're not a robot. Type the characters shown in the image into the provided field. Finally, hit the 'Login' or 'Submit' button. If all your details are correct, you should be logged into your account dashboard. Easy peasy, right? If you encounter any issues, don't panic! We'll cover troubleshooting next.

Troubleshooting Common Login Issues

Okay, so sometimes, despite our best efforts, the Janam Praman Patra website login doesn't go as smoothly as planned. Don't sweat it, guys, this happens to everyone! The most common hiccup is usually a forgotten password. If you've entered your password and it's not working, look for a link that says something like 'Forgot Password?' or 'Reset Password'. Clicking this will usually take you through a process to reset it, often involving sending a link to your registered email or an OTP to your registered mobile number. Make sure you check your spam or junk folder in your email if you don't see the reset email. Another frequent issue is incorrect username or email ID. Double-check that you're using the exact username or email you registered with. Typos are super common here! Sometimes, it's as simple as mistyping one letter. If you're still unsure, try to recall which email you might have used during registration. A Captcha error can also be frustrating. If the Captcha image is unclear, look for an option to refresh it or get a new one. Make sure you're typing it exactly as it appears, including case sensitivity if applicable. Lastly, if you're consistently facing problems, it could be a temporary issue with the website itself or your internet connection. Try clearing your browser's cache and cookies, or try logging in from a different browser or device. If all else fails, the 'Contact Us' or 'Help' section on the website is your best friend. They usually have support staff who can guide you through specific issues. Remember, persistence is key, and most login problems have a simple solution.

Security Best Practices for Your Account

Now that you're logged into the Janam Praman Patra website and have access to your important details, let's talk about keeping things safe. Security is no joke, guys, especially when it involves personal government records. The first and most crucial step is to create a strong, unique password. Don't use easily guessable information like your birthday, pet's name, or simple sequential numbers. A good password combines uppercase and lowercase letters, numbers, and symbols. Aim for a length of at least 12 characters. Never share your login credentials with anyone, not even close family members. Your username and password are the keys to your account, and sharing them is like leaving your front door unlocked. Another critical practice is to log out of your account whenever you finish using the portal, especially if you're using a shared or public computer. Don't just close the browser tab; actively look for the 'Logout' or 'Sign Out' button to ensure your session is properly terminated. Be wary of phishing attempts. Government websites usually won't ask for your password via email or SMS. If you receive any suspicious communication asking for your login details, ignore it and report it to the website administrators if possible. Lastly, make sure your device is secure. Use reputable antivirus software, keep your operating system and browser updated, and avoid logging in on unsecured public Wi-Fi networks. By following these best practices, you're significantly reducing the risk of unauthorized access and keeping your Janam Praman Patra account secure.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Let's tackle some common questions you might have about the Janam Praman Patra website login.

Q1: What if I forget my username?

A: If you forget your username, look for a 'Forgot Username?' link on the login page, similar to the 'Forgot Password?' option. You might need to provide your registered email ID or mobile number to retrieve it.

Q2: Can I apply for a birth certificate without logging in?

A: Generally, most government portals require you to log in to apply for services like birth certificates to ensure secure and trackable applications. However, some might have offline options or limited guest access for certain tasks. It's best to check the specific website's options.

Q3: How long does it take to get my birth certificate after applying online?

A: Processing times can vary significantly depending on your location and the specific government department. It can range from a few days to a few weeks. You can usually track the status of your application after logging in.

Q4: Is the Janam Praman Patra website secure for my personal information?

A: Yes, official government websites are designed with security protocols to protect your personal data. However, it's crucial for users to also follow security best practices, like using strong passwords and logging out properly.

Q5: What should I do if I face technical issues during login?

A: If you encounter technical glitches, first try clearing your browser cache and cookies, or try a different browser. If the problem persists, contact the website's support or helpline for assistance. Check the 'Contact Us' or 'Help' section.
